Thorsten Reppert is a researcher and doctoral student at the Chair of Public Policy, affiliated with the Bamberg Graduate School of Social Sciences (BAGSS) at Otto-Friedrich University of Bamberg. His work bridges Political Science and Public Policy, focusing on electricity grid ownership transitions and local governance.
- Education: MA in Political Science (University of Bamberg, 2021); BA in Political and Social Studies & Business Management and Economics (University of Würzburg, 2018).

His research examines how partisan dynamics and institutional change shape energy policy at the municipal level, particularly the re-municipalization of electricity grids. Publications highlight trends in local-level ownership and party influence on infrastructure governance.
- Conferences:
- ECPR General Conference 2024 (Dublin): Presentation on comparative local electricity grid dynamics
- DVPW Political Economy Section 2023 (Witten): Analysis of ownership shifts
